History of Prayer at the Heart

  • PATH started with 2 national virtual prayer calls that have been viewed by more than 100,000 people.

  • Thousands of people from all 50 states attended a national prayer gathering at the heart of America (Lebanon, KS) in July 2021

 

Vision for Prayer at the Heart of Wisconsin

  • Through a series of God encounters, we were led to hold our gathering in Dorchester, WI, which happens to be near one of the four corners of the world.

  • We are calling believers of all generations, ethnic backgrounds, and denominations from all 72 counties of Wisconsin to join in this historic moment for our state.

  • We are going before the Lord with humble, unified prayer, asking Him to forgive our sins, heal our land, and bring revival and awakening to our hearts. (2 Chronicles 7:14)

What to expect

  • Teams assembled from around the state will lead us in worship. We will have leaders facilitating times of prayer, decrees, and declarations. There will also be times of “rapid fire” prayer, where people release a 15-30 second prayer over Wisconsin.

  • We will have a time where we all take communion together, remembering what Jesus has done for us.
